Purchased a steering stabilizer that was supposed to be a direct fitment for my 2010 F250. U-bolts provided with Kit did not fit, returned to shop where I bought them. Second kit, same issue, u-bolts for brackets did not fit. Called Pro Comp customer service, said there are two option bend the U-bolts or take back. Lame, it would seem that they would provide the correct U-bolts for the systems they sell, and stand by their product. Apparently, the offroad shop says they have to bend all of them, and have for years. Funny, the bolts don't fit the supplied bracket or the tie rod out of the box, sounds like an engineering issue to me (maybe quality control?) Weak pro comp. Just because you have been selling the wrong part for years, doesn't mean it shouldn't be fixed. Go with Rancho, I wish I would have. I purchased the procomp lift kit k4015b for my 2001 superduty. With less than 3000 miles and no more than 1 yr old, the front springs on the kit dropped to over 1" 1/2 lower. I have contacted procomp on this issue and i was imformed that i can buy new springs and recieve a credit so a couple months later i have tried to contact procomp to return the springs for new ones. I called several times and left messages, NO ONE has returned my call!! I have also emailed them and NO return email! With that being said, i have taken their lift off my truck and purchased a rough country lift for it. Procomp your lift is getting recycled! After reviewing the lift rough country sent, i would strongly recommend to any one buy the rough country. Rough Country is 100% better product!
My procomp front spring only had 5 leafs in it. The new ones from rough country have 10 leafs and are much better quality!!
